Understanding the Crucial Role of a Scrum Master in Agile Projects
In the dynamic landscape of agile project management, the Scrum Master emerges as a pivotal figure in driving project success. While some may view this position as just another job title, it’s essential to recognize the distinct responsibilities and expertise that define this role. This article will delve into the integral functions of a Scrum Master within agile projects, highlighting their invaluable contributions to achieving project excellence.
Facilitating Agile Practices
The primary responsibility of a Scrum Master is to facilitate and promote agile practices within the team. They act as a coach, guiding team members on how to effectively implement and follow agile methodologies such as Scrum. This involves organizing and facilitating daily stand-up meetings, sprint planning sessions, sprint reviews, and retrospectives.
By ensuring that these practices are followed consistently, the Scrum Master helps create an environment where collaboration, transparency, and continuous improvement thrive. They encourage team members to embrace self-organization and take ownership of their tasks while providing guidance when needed.
Removing Roadblocks
Another vital aspect of the Scrum Master’s role is to identify and eliminate any roadblocks that may hinder the progress of the team. This could include anything from technical issues to organizational obstacles or even interpersonal conflicts among team members.
The Scrum Master acts as a facilitator between different stakeholders involved in the project. They work closely with product owners, developers, testers, and other team members to ensure smooth communication and coordination. By addressing roadblocks promptly, they enable the team to focus on delivering value without unnecessary delays or distractions.
Ensuring Continuous Improvement
Continuous improvement is at the core of agile methodologies, and it is the responsibility of the Scrum Master to foster this mindset within the team. They encourage regular retrospectives where team members reflect on what went well during each sprint and what areas need improvement.
Based on the insights gained from these retrospectives, the Scrum Master helps the team identify and implement action items to enhance their productivity and effectiveness. They also facilitate knowledge sharing and encourage experimentation with new approaches or tools that could benefit the team’s performance.
Promoting Collaboration and Empowerment
Effective collaboration is essential for agile projects, and the Scrum Master plays a vital role in fostering this collaborative culture. They promote cross-functional teamwork by encouraging open communication, active listening, and respect among team members.
The Scrum Master ensures that everyone’s opinions are heard during discussions, empowering each individual to contribute their expertise. They also act as a shield for the team, protecting them from external disturbances or unnecessary pressure.
In conclusion, a Scrum Master is a key player in agile projects. Their role goes beyond being a project manager; they act as facilitators, problem solvers, coaches, and advocates of continuous improvement. By understanding the unique responsibilities of a Scrum Master in agile projects, organizations can harness their expertise to drive successful project outcomes.
This text was generated using a large language model, and select text has been reviewed and moderated for purposes such as readability.